The SPOOF/UNAUTH ACCESS team will ask for documentation from you to go forward (to make sure we are talking to the correct party). The process will take 30 days to investigate/resolve.

They will ask for:

a) id
b) police report
c) affidavit

As always, please use extreme caution with your passwords. I would highly recommend NOT using the same email/password combinations used at another site.

It takes 30 days because the activities have to be reviewed, check the documents, reports, the possibility of other accounts that are impacted...in addition to working the claim through the insurance agent.
